Modi cabinet approves amendment to Medical Termination of Pregnancy act, taking abortion limit to 24 weeks instead of 20. Bill to be tabled in Parliament.
In 1971, India became one of the first countries to legalise abortion, but today its healthcare system is lagging behind and doing a great disservice to women.
Abortion has been legal for 48 years but is still not based on women's rights. Moreover, experts argue it isn't in line with current medical and societal standards.
A majority of Indian women looking to undergo abortions do so by self-medication or through quacks because of the stigma around the procedure and lack of awareness.
